About the area
Ronald, Washington, nestled in the heart of the Cascade Mountains, is a hidden gem that offers a serene escape into nature. This quaint community is a gateway to outdoor adventures and a peaceful retreat for those looking to unwind from the hustle and bustle of city life.
The area is a paradise for outdoor enthusiasts, with the nearby Cle Elum Lake providing a perfect setting for boating, fishing, and swimming during the warmer months. The lake's crystal-clear waters and scenic surroundings make it an ideal spot for picnics and family gatherings. In the winter, the landscape transforms into a snowy wonderland, with opportunities for snowmobiling, cross-country skiing, and snowshoeing in the surrounding forests.
Hiking trails abound, offering visitors the chance to explore the natural beauty of the region. Trails range from easy walks to challenging treks, leading adventurers through dense forests, alpine meadows, and to breathtaking vistas of the surrounding mountain peaks. The Coal Mines Trail, for example, is a historic path that takes hikers on a journey through the area's mining past, with interpretive signs detailing the region's history.
For those interested in the cultural aspects of Ronald, the town's history as a coal mining community is on display at the Roslyn Museum. The museum showcases artifacts and photographs that tell the story of the miners and their families who once lived and worked in the area.
Accommodations in Ronald range from cozy cabins to luxurious lodges, catering to all preferences and budgets. Many of these lodgings offer stunning mountain views and easy access to outdoor activities, ensuring that nature is always at your doorstep.
The nearby town of Roslyn is also worth a visit, with its charming historic downtown, unique shops, and local eateries. The Brick Saloon, Washington's oldest continuously operating bar, offers a glimpse into the past with its authentic 19th-century atmosphere.
Ronald's proximity to the Snoqualmie Pass also makes it a convenient stop for those traveling across the state or seeking a mountain adventure.
